OutSystems/Full Stack Developer

  • Chicago - United States
  • Full-time

We are expanding the Highland Solutions team with an OutSystems Developer. Highland Solutions is a highly collaborative organization fostering an environment social and technical excellence This position is a fabulous opportunity for an established developer comfortable working with the Microsoft stack and eager to learn new technologies! The role is primarily on-site, open to contract, contract to hire or full-time employee, in Chicago’s downtown loop. 

Purpose 

The OutSystems Developer plays a critical role by leading the technical aspects of our OutSystems projects working directly with our prospects and clients. The OutSystems developer will be responsible for combining programming experience and visual expertise to provide guidance and ensure fit-for-purpose solutions that are scalable and maintainable. This role will master OutSystems Platform technology in conjunction with modern software engineering practices for developing web and mobile business applications. 

Duties and Responsibilities 

Develop customized solutions for clients in the OutSystems platform, creating functional components of UX and UI requirements following Agile methodologies. 

Tackle complex technical problems following OutSystems development best practices, ensuring solution performance and users adoption. 

Working as a team helps design and develop custom features and application components using agreed team and company practices. Program and develop integrations with external systems to meet business workflow needs. 

Act as a champion to the OutSystems Development team, mentor, train and coach other OutSystems developers. 

Collaborate with Sales to build prototypes and proofs-of-concept for prospects and clients. 

Analyzes and implements user stories based on objectives/acceptance criteria. Participates in test case development for expected functional and performance requirements 

Participates in team and company growth. Updates development knowledge base, new design/development technologies and software products, participates in educational opportunities and other professional growth resources. 

Delivers value to customers. Enhances Highland's reputation by accepting ownership for quality. Explores opportunities to add value to job accomplishments through innovative solutions development. 

Holds themselves and their team members accountable for delivering high value and quality to clients, and provides high-transparency by identifying information needs and facilitating communication. 

Experience Requirements:


Required 

1-3 years experience with Microsoft Stack, C# or .NET required. 

Web application development, process design and project delivery practices. 

Understanding of solution architecture, design and web application performance. 

Excellent written and verbal communication skills 

Ability to work on an Agile development team on multiple fast-track projects 

Client-facing consulting experience 

Preferred 

OutSystems development experience and certifications are a plus although training will be provided 

4+ years working with HTML/CSS/JS stack & related frameworks 

Advanced HTML and CSS authoring skills using non-visual tools and IDE’s 

Front-end Javascript platform experience: Backbone / Handlebars / Underscore 

Knowledge of database modeling and programming with databases: SQL Server, Oracle or MySQL. 

Web Publishing/CMS: integration with blog and networking platforms, commercial content management system template design; Wordpress 

Experience with reactive and event-driven architecture 

Experience with responsive UI architecture 

Education Requirements 

Bachelor’s degree in Computer Programming, CS/IT or equivalent experience 

Compensation:


Salary position based on current market value 

Voluntary participation company health and wellness benefits 

Voluntary participation in the company 401K program

 

Disclaimer: This job offer was originally posted on SimplyHired.